Legal Status of Online Betting
The legal betting sites in Tanzania are regulated by the Tanzania Lotteries and Gaming Board (TLGB), which oversees all forms of gambling, including online platforms. While land-based betting is well-established, online betting requires operators to obtain licenses from the TLGB to operate legally. This framework ensures transparency, fair play, and consumer protection. Users must verify that their chosen platform is licensed to avoid fraudulent activities and safeguard their financial information.

Economic Impact of Betting in Tanzania
The betting industry contributes to Tanzania’s economy by generating revenue for the government through taxes and creating employment opportunities in tech, finance, and customer service sectors. Legal betting sites also support local sports development by sponsoring teams and events. However, the sector’s growth must be balanced with measures to address potential social challenges, such as financial strain on vulnerable populations.
